Prior to Sunday’s matchup with Arsenal, Chelsea manager Graham Potter provided a team report.

Graham Potter has elaborated on Ben Chilwell’s injury from their most recent outing and Kepa’s lingering ailment ahead of Chelsea’s Premier League match against Arsenal this Sunday.

Goalkeeper Kepa Arrizabalaga is now unavailable, but Mateo Kovacic, a midfielder, might play.

“Kepa, no. I don’t think he will play before the World Cup.

“Kovacic trained today so he will be in contention.

“Carney [Chukwuemeka] has a slight issue with his hamstring that we are getting to the bottom of,” Potter said.

The Blues will be trying to recover from last weekend’s 4-1 loss against Potter’s old team, Brighton.

Currently, Chelsea is in sixth place, 10 points back of first-place Arsenal.
